四季轮回编程可以通过多种方式实现,具体取决于你想要创建的应用类型和编程语言。以下是两种常见的方法:
方法一:使用动画软件
如果你想要创建一个动画,可以使用如Adobe After Effects、Animate CC等动画软件来实现四季轮回的效果。以下是使用Animate CC的步骤:
导入背景图片及四季图片
打开动画文件“四季如歌”。
执行“插入”→“场景”命令,进入“场景2”的编辑窗口。
导入“背景”图片,并将图层重命名为“背景”。
建立新图层并重命名为“四季”。在第2帧上单击,按F7键将帧设置为空白关键帧,并导入“春桃”图片。
分别在第20帧、第40帧、第60帧上单击,按F7键,然后依次导入“夏荷”、“秋色”、“冬雪”图片。在第80帧上单击,按F7键将其设置为空白关键帧。
添加遮罩层
在“四季”图层上新建一个图层并重命名为“遮罩”。
在第2帧上按F7键,将该帧设为空白关键帧,并使用“椭圆工具”在舞台上绘制一个小椭圆形。
在第20帧上按F6键插入关键帧,将该圆放大到能盖住被遮罩层中的“春桃”图片。
在第21帧上按F7键,使用“矩形工具”在舞台一侧绘制一个小矩形。
在第40帧上按F6键,插入关键帧,将该矩形放大。
在第41帧上按F7键,使用“矩形工具”在舞台上方绘制一个小矩形。
在第60帧上按F6键,插入关键帧,将该矩形放大到能盖住被遮罩层中的“夏荷”图片。
方法二:使用编程语言
如果你想要通过编程来实现四季轮回的效果,可以使用如Java等编程语言。以下是一个简单的Java示例,用于判断输入的月份属于哪个季节:
```java
import java.util.Scanner;
public class OperatorDemo {
public static void main(String[] args) {
// 创建Scanner对象以接收用户输入
Scanner sc = new Scanner(System.in);
System.out.println("请输入一个月份:");
int month = sc.nextInt();
// 使用switch语句判断月份并输出对应的季节
String season;
switch (month) {
case 1: case 2: case 12:
season = "冬";
break;
case 3: case 4: case 5:
season = "春";
break;
case 6: case 7: case 8:
season = "夏";
break;
case 9: case 10: case 11:
season = "秋";
break;
default:
season = "无效的月份";
break;
}
// 输出结果
System.out.println("输入的月份 " + month + " 属于 " + season + " 季节。");
}
}
```
建议
选择合适的方法:根据你的具体需求和技能水平选择合适的方法。如果你不熟悉编程,使用动画软件可能更简单直观。如果你对编程有浓厚兴趣,可以尝试编写一个简单的程序来实现相同的效果。
注意细节:无论是动画还是编程,细节往往决定成败。确保在实现过程中注意细节,比如遮罩层的创建和动画的流畅性。
测试和调试:在完成后,务必进行充分的测试和调试,确保程序或动画能够按照预期运行。